Physics provides models of the physical world including electricity, magnetism, optics and mechanics.
Technology involves the use of scientific knowledge to develop tools, machines, and systems to solve problems and improve efficiency. Physics plays a key role in technology by providing the fundamental principles and laws that govern the behavior of matter and energy, which are essential for the design and functioning of technological devices and systems. Technologies such as computers, smartphones, and satellites rely on principles of physics to operate effectively.
